The boundless darkness is terrifying, and it can sink the soul completely.

She didn't know how much time had passed, only that she seemed to have been struggling in this endless darkness, and she could hear the sound of water rushing in her ears, with an icy breath flowing on the surface of her body.

I...... Who am I?

Her thoughts were chaotic throughout, unable to think clearly and logically, until at one point, she breathed slowly, and suddenly realized that the firm shackles that had lasted for an unknown amount of time seemed to be gradually loosening, and new questions emerged from the depths of her consciousness and echoed in her mind......

Where am I? Who's hurting me? What about my companions?

She didn't know how long this state lasted, until that moment, she suddenly noticed that the whole world became clear, the endless darkness was illuminated by the light piercing through the cracks, and there was a noise in her ears, as if there were many people shouting something inaudible.

The clear sound of shattering became the final stimulus, allowing her to see the light she had not seen for a long time, and the image in front of her was still a little blurry, but as her vision became clearer, she found herself bound by some kind of chain against the wall behind her. Strangely, the chains weren't very strong, and after breaking the restraints with a little force, she thought to herself a little confused, for some reason, she didn't think it should be.

She staggered to her feet on the smooth ground, and the sensation coming from her body seemed strange, but she didn't bother to think about it that much at this point...... Or rather, she seems to be in a half-dreaming state, and her thought process seems blurry. As she stumbled out of the room that seemed to be shaky, she saw about a dozen Shiokai people with various weapons and special symbols on their bodies, looking at it with a wary expression. They didn't relax when they saw her, but instead aimed their weapons at her.

It was the emblem of the Quds Law Enforcement Team, and the phrase appeared in memory.

But does it make any sense? She thought in a daze, but she couldn't decipher the specific meaning of the sentence, all she knew was that one of the people in front of her shouted something, and then the others didn't hesitate to launch a strange device at her...... It was an inconspicuous-looking little thing, and there was a faint tingling sensation on her, but there was only so much to it about.

She took a few more steps forward, which obviously startled the Shiohai people a lot. They were shouting something, but they couldn't tell what was being said when they were completely audible...... There was no memory loss, no inaudible hearing, just as the brain couldn't process this information, and she couldn't understand what they were saying.

She looked at them with some confusion, but the action made the Shiokai people cry out even louder, and several of them threw out a large white net, which seemed to be made of tough sea tree silk threads, and followed the current directly around her body.

The net was indeed tough, and she tried to tear the mesh with brute force, but the force was cleverly unloaded by its structure, so she couldn't force it out, and the Shiokai people pulled the net hard while assembling weapons that they had never seen before.

Even though she couldn't analyze the situation rationally now, her instinct made her feel that it was dangerous, something that could really cause her serious damage, and under the instinctive reaction of the creature to the danger, she struggled to escape from the net, but could not tear through the tough wires.

If only there was something sharp that could cut the threads, she thought, and the thought just turned, and the wire on her body cracked as if something had cut it. Without having time to think about it, she jerked free from her restraints again, and ran all the way through the unprepared Shiokai people, fleeing there.

It's dangerous, run, run, you have to get out of here as soon as possible......

The world was once again in chaos, light and darkness flickering rapidly, sounds and images turning into blurred phantoms. She couldn't remember exactly what she had encountered, only that some force was driving her to run, to run, to run...... Those Shiokai people felt as if they were vulnerable, they couldn't keep up with her speed at all, and for some reason, she felt like they would shatter when they touched it.

So instead of touching them, she chose to flee from the place that made her feel dangerous. She didn't know where she was going, she just kept running away, without rest or pause, like a machine walking towards the unknown end.

She didn't know how long she had been running, but it was definitely not a short time, and it wasn't until the touch of nothingness passed through her body, and the bright light she had never seen before stung her eyes, and her consciousness was awake again.

She looked up, and it was a glow too bright for her eyes to bear, shining on the world at infinity heights...... She seemed to have crossed a boundary, and the current of water that had filled her body suddenly disappeared, replaced by some very hollow and eerie feeling.

Where am I? Where the hell is this? Why am I here?

She stared blankly at the top of the water, a sight she had never seen before, the boundless sea had reached the limit of height, turning into a rippling plane, refracting the bright light of the sun in the sky. There seemed to be something above her head, and as she thought about it, she could clearly feel that she could control the thing above her head to bend down...... Then she saw some kind of slender tentacle slowly bend in front of her, the tip splitting into dozens of tinkerer tentacles, all wrapped around a small orb of shimmering yellow light.

This is...... The part of her? Even though something didn't feel right, after trying a few times and discovering that she could take full control of this weird organ, she had to admit that it seemed to be part of her body, and then, she discovered something even weirder. She had been in this void for a while, but she didn't feel uncomfortable, it shouldn't be, she thought, she didn't seem to be able to stay in this environment for long, but now she could.

She turned her head and saw something called land, a world beyond the edge of the sea, a world where the people of the Tide Sea could not really stay. When these contents emerge from vague memories, the confused mind makes this judgment...... Those Shiohai people seem to want to hunt her down, she doesn't want to kill Shiohai people, then they should not be able to find her, once they go to land, they will not be found.

Then, she decided to leave the waters that felt familiar to her, and although she was completely unknown to the land, she had no fear...... It's strange that she seems to have completely lost her fear, and she never felt fear no matter what she encountered.

Even when she found that something seemed wrong, she could not feel a trace of fear or uneasiness, and after stepping onto the rising continental shelf, she looked back at the deep ocean and gently reached out to reach into the rippling sea again. Then, as if for the first time, she noticed her palms and the reflection of the sea.

Instead of the iconic cyan exoskeleton carapace of the Shiokai people, the surface of the palm is covered by something like a ruby. As she tried to clench her palm, she could see a faint glow circulating in the red hedrons, like nerve signals. As she looked down, she saw that she was also covered with a similar shell, and there were several small devices stuck to it that the Shiohai people had shot at her before, and she immediately grabbed them and threw them into the sea. Between the joints of the body, there seemed to be many sharp blade-like structures growing, and these things seemed to shimmer with a terrifying cold light...... Maybe it's these things that cut through the big net of tenacity that was before. She couldn't see her own eyes, which was weird, and when she saw the reflection of her face on the surface of the sea, all she could see was that the face was a smooth crystalline surface, and there were only two hollows where the eyes should be, and there were no eyeballs, but she was really looking with her eyes.

Who is this monster? This monster is...... I?

She was slightly stunned, as if she understood why the Xihai people were looking at her with frightened eyes before, although she didn't know what was going on, she didn't want to kill them, and she didn't want to be caught by them, so she had to flee to a place where they couldn't catch up...... It was great that she found that she seemed to be able to live in the air, and that memory told her that those Shiokai people couldn't do it.

She still couldn't swim, but she had reached the end of the sea after running for an unknown amount of time, and at this point, she just had to keep moving towards land...... The buoyancy of the water made her body heavy, but her muscles seemed to be much stronger, and she could even continue to move forward in that void environment, and finally her feet stepped out of the shallow water, exposing every corner of her body to the air. The seawater on the surface of the crystal was gradually evaporating by the sun's rays in the sky, and she did not feel burned by ultraviolet rays, nor was she uncomfortable with the dry air.

She stood a little dumbfounded, looking at the completely unfamiliar world in front of her, and this action continued for a long time, until a green light suddenly shot out from the trees in front of her and struck her in the head.

It was a laser beam that was enough to penetrate the brain for an ordinary creature, but the attack on the surface of the body covered with red crystals was immediately absorbed by this strange crystal, refracted into countless rays of light scattered in different directions, and she immediately instinctively ran to the source of the beam, and saw the bug lying on the trunk of the tree with a huge focused crystal on its back, which was obviously a laser bug.

Her body seemed to act more than her brain could think, and without even measuring the consequences of doing so, her palm had already grabbed the laser worm, which she didn't know what was going on, and blasted its body mercilessly, pulling out the beautiful focused crystal and throwing it into her mouth.

It seemed to taste good, and she said of the first meal she enjoyed on land, with no pity for the laser bugs. One last glance at the rippling sea, she turned and headed inland.
